In this, the first ever biography of Cheryl Cole, Gerard Sanderson takes
an intimate look at the Geordie superstar's amazing journey: from
growing up on a council estate in Newcastle to storming the charts with
Girls Aloud.
With childhood success winning beauty and talent
competitions, it was clear from an early age that Cheryl was destined
for great things. As part of the glamorous girl group Girls Aloud, she
has garnered critical and popular acclaim, with a record-breaking
eighteen singles in a row reaching the UK Top Ten.
Now famous in her own right as an X-Factor
judge, and as half of one of the most photographed celebrity couples
thanks to her marriage to footballer Ashley Cole, the stunning star's
meteoric rise to fame is recounted for the first time.
